O papel da mulher indígena no campo literário e político: o caso de Eliane Potiguara
The role of indigenous women in the literary and political field: the case of Eliane Potiguara
Abstract:
The aim of this master's thesis is to explore the historical, cultural and political situation development of indigenous women in Brazil, with an emphasis on Eliane Potiguara. The thesis presents her work Metade cara, metade máscara, in which the author analyses the European invasion and colonial violence against indigenous people. The thesis also includes the poetry of this author, in which she discusses …moreAbstract:
